It also includes the original gateway for the historic New Mill Brewery which dates back to 1859 so it offers the opportunity to own a unique piece of local history.

It's this old gateway, as well as the curved walls, that immediately draw your attention to this unusual period property. Above the gateway arch, along with the date, the Brewery name was inscribed on the stone. Only part of it remains as, apparently, the words ‘New Mill' were chipped away deliberately during World War II as a matter of national security so that any invading Germans would not be able to get their bearings!
